.banner{background: url(../img/Slicebanner.png)top center no-repeat;height: 460px;}
.title{margin: 50px 0 29px;}
.sj a{float: left;margin-right: 10px;margin-bottom: 14px;}
.sj a:nth-child(5n){margin-right: 0;}
/* .sj a:nth-child(5),.sj a:nth-child(7){border-bottom: 0;} */
/* .sj a:nth-child(5) img,.sj a:nth-child(7) img{height: 86px;width: 232px;} */
/* .sj a:nth-child(1){border-bottom-left-radius: 4px;} */
/* .sj a:nth-child(5){border-bottom-right-radius: 4px;} */
/* .sj a:nth-child(-n+5){margin-bottom: 14px;} */

.sjqd .fl{background: url(../img/Slicecjbg.png) center center no-repeat;width: 500px;height: 584px;}
.sjqd .fl .map{background: url(../img/Slicemap.png) 42px 91px no-repeat;width: 500px;height: 584px;position: relative;}
.sjqd .fl .map a{position: absolute;width: 28px;}
.sjqd .fl .map .zz{background: url(../img/Slicezzs.png)center center no-repeat;height: 65px;left: 212px;top: 204px;}
.sjqd .fl .map .ay{background: url(../img/Sliceays.png)center center no-repeat;height: 65px;left: 259px;top: 58px;}
.sjqd .fl .map .py{background: url(../img/Slicepys.png)center center no-repeat;height: 65px;left: 345px;top: 90px;}
.sjqd .fl .map .hb{background: url(../img/Slicehbs.png)center center no-repeat;height: 65px;left: 287px;top: 121px;}
.sjqd .fl .map .jy{background: url(../img/Slicejys.png)center center no-repeat;height: 65px;left: 155px;top: 144px;}
.sjqd .fl .map .jz{background: url(../img/Slicejzs.png)center center no-repeat;height: 65px;left: 201px;top: 138px;}
.sjqd .fl .map .xx{background: url(../img/Slicexxs.png)center center no-repeat;height: 65px;left: 253px;top: 151px;}
.sjqd .fl .map .kf{background: url(../img/Slicekfs.png)center center no-repeat;height: 65px;left: 286px;top: 204px;}
.sjqd .fl .map .smx{background: url(../img/Slicesmx.png)center center no-repeat;height: 79px;left: 61px;top: 248px;}
.sjqd .fl .map .ly{background: url(../img/Slicelys.png)center center no-repeat;height: 65px;left: 144px;top: 242px;}
.sjqd .fl .map .xc{background: url(../img/Slicexcs.png)center center no-repeat;height: 65px;left: 242px;top: 253px;}
.sjqd .fl .map .sq{background: url(../img/Slicesqs.png)center center no-repeat;height: 65px;left: 377px;top: 224px;}
.sjqd .fl .map .lh{background: url(../img/Slicelhs.png)center center no-repeat;height: 79px;left: 273px;top: 288px;}
.sjqd .fl .map .zk{background: url(../img/Slicezks.png)center center no-repeat;height: 65px;left: 328px;top: 292px;}
.sjqd .fl .map .ny{background: url(../img/Slicenys.png)center center no-repeat;height: 65px;left: 144px;top: 345px;}
.sjqd .fl .map .xy{background: url(../img/Slicexys.png)center center no-repeat;height: 65px;left: 320px;top: 438px;}
.sjqd .fl .map .pds{background: url(../img/Slicepds.png)center center no-repeat;height: 79px;left: 193px;top: 276px;}
.sjqd .fl .map .zmd{background: url(../img/Slicezmd.png)center center no-repeat;height: 79px;left: 275px;top: 360px;}

.sjqd .fr .hd li{
  width: 140px;
height: 81px;
flex-shrink: 0;
border: 1px solid #EECFC2;
background: #FBFBFB;
float: left;
text-align: center;
line-height: 81px;
}
.sjqd .fr .hd li.on{background: #D40901;border: 1px solid #D40901;}
.sjqd .fr .hd li a{color: #d40901;font-size: 26px;
font-weight: 500;}
.sjqd .fr .hd li.on a{ font-size: 30px;font-weight: 900; color: #ffffff;}
.sjqd .fr .bd{background: url(../img/Slicesjtextbg.png)center center no-repeat;padding: 36px 10px 20px 26px;width: 700px;height: 503px;}
.sjqd .fr .bd ul{position: relative;width: 100%;height: 100%;}
.sjqd .fr .bd ul li{width: 328px;float: left;background: url(../img/Slicelibg.png)left center no-repeat;padding-left: 20px; color: #333333;font-size: 18px;line-height: 42px;}
.sjqd .fr .bd ul li span{
width: 86px;
height: 30px;
border-radius: 4px;
background: #FFFAF8;
text-align: center;
line-height: 30px;
display: inline-block;
 color: #ac816f;
 font-size: 16px;
 margin-left: 11px;
}
.sjqd .fr .bd ul .more{
color: #fff0e0;
width: 128px;
height: 43px;
border-radius: 78px;
background: #D40901;
text-align: center;
line-height: 43px;
display: block;
position: absolute;
bottom: 0;
left: 50%;
transform: translateX(-50%);
}

.ydzjs .fl{background: url(../img/Slicejsbg.png)center center no-repeat;width: 587px;height: 375px;padding: 71px 28px 31px;}
.ydzjs .fl p{font-size: 22px;line-height: 29px;margin-top: 15px;padding: 0 12px;color: #000000;}
.ydzjs .fr{background: url(../img/Slicegnbg.png)center center no-repeat;width: 587px;height: 375px;padding: 88px 42px 40px 46px;}
.ydzjs .fr p{font-size: 22px;line-height: 29px;margin-top: 15px;padding: 0 11px 0 12px;color:#FFFCFB;}
.ydzjs{margin-bottom: 36px;}

.ydzsl{background: url(../img/Sliceslbg.png)center center no-repeat;width: 100%;height: 630px;padding: 95px 78px 30px 42px;}
.ydzsl .fl p{font-size: 18px; color: #b42727;font-weight: 700;line-height: 29px;width: 146px;}
.ydzsl .fl p:nth-child(2){margin: 54px 0 263px;}
.ydzsl .fr{width: 895px;margin-top: 8px;}
.ydzsl .fr>p{ color: #fffaf2; font-size: 20px; line-height: 29px;}
.ydzsl .fr .box{
margin: 57px 0 62px;
}
.ydzsl .fr .box p{color: #8B4A1B;font-size: 20px; line-height: 29px;}
.ydzsl .fr .box .b{font-weight: 600;}
.ydzsl .fr .box .b:nth-child(3){margin-top: 14px;}
.ydzsl .fr .box p:nth-child(4){margin-bottom: 14px;}
.ydzsl .fr .box p a{color: #DA2B00;display: inline-block;border-bottom: 1px solid #DA2B00;font-weight: 600;}
.up{padding-bottom: 84px;}

.ydzc{background: url(../img/Slicejdbg.png)center center no-repeat;height: 1080px;}
.ydzc .wrap .title{margin: 22px 0 30px;}

.zczs{background: url(../img/Slicezcbtm.png) bottom center no-repeat;width: 100%;height: 300px;padding: 0 52px;}
.zczs .item{background: url(../img/Slicezcs.png)center center no-repeat;width: 196px;height: 212px;margin-right: 28px;padding: 37px 50px 0 27px; font-size: 17px;font-weight: 700;line-height: 29px;text-align: center;}
.zczs .item:nth-child(5){margin-right: 0;}
.zczs .item a{color: #cb2323;display: block;width: 100%;height: 100%;}

.zcjd{position:relative;margin-top: 30px;}
.zcjd .prev,
.zcjd .next{position:absolute;top: 35%;cursor: pointer;width: 45px;font-size: 60px;color: #b42727;height: 100px;text-align: center;transform: scaleY(1.5);}
.zcjd .prev{left: -45px;}
.zcjd .next{right: -45px;}
.zcjd li{ width: 380px;height: auto;margin: 20px 10px;float: left; }
.zcjd .item{width: 380px;height: 280px;background-color: #b42727;padding: 10px 15px;border-radius: 4px;}
.zcjd .item:nth-child(2n){margin-right: 0;}
.zcjd .item img{width: 100%;height: 215px;}
.zcjd .item p{ color: #fef6c8; font-size: 18px;line-height: 29px;font-weight: 700;margin-top: 13px;font-family: "Source Han Serif CN";text-overflow: ellipsis;overflow: hidden;white-space: nowrap;}


.hd2{position: relative;}
.hd2>div{position: absolute;}
.hd2 .icon1{left: 0;top: 20px;}
.hd2 .icon2{left: 40px;top: 130px;}


/* 900000000000000000 */
.sjqd{position: relative;}
.sjqd .hd{position: absolute;width: 700px;right: 0;}
.sjqd .hd li{
  width: 140px;
height: 81px;
flex-shrink: 0;
border: 1px solid #EECFC2;
background: #FBFBFB;
float: left;
text-align: center;
line-height: 81px;
color: #d40901;font-size: 26px;
font-weight: 500;
cursor: pointer;
}
.sjqd .hd li.on{background: #D40901;border: 1px solid #D40901;font-size: 30px;font-weight: 900; color: #ffffff;}
.sjqd .bd .fr{background: url(../img/Slicesjtextbg.png)center center no-repeat;padding: 36px 10px 20px 26px;width: 700px;height: 503px;margin-top: 81px;}
/* .sjqd .bd ul{position: relative;width: 100%;height: 100%;}
.sjqd .bd ul li{width: 328px;float: left;background: url(../img/Slicelibg.png)left center no-repeat;padding-left: 20px; color: #333333;font-size: 18px;line-height: 42px;} */


.sjqd .fl{background: url(../img/Slicecjbg.png) center center no-repeat;width: 500px;height: 584px; position: relative;}
/* .sjqd .fl .map{background: url(../img/Slicemap.png) 42px 91px no-repeat;width: 500px;height: 584px;position: relative;} */
.sjqd .fl  a{position: absolute;width: 26px;z-index: 999;background-size: 100% 100%;}
.sjqd .fl  .zz{background: url(../img/Slicezzs.png)center center no-repeat;height: 60px;left: 212px;top: 204px;background-size: 100% 100%;}
.sjqd .fl  .ay{background: url(../img/Sliceays.png)center center no-repeat;height: 60px;left: 259px;top: 50px;background-size: 100% 100%;}
.sjqd .fl  .py{background: url(../img/Slicepys.png)center center no-repeat;height: 60px;left: 345px;top: 70px;background-size: 100% 100%;}
.sjqd .fl  .hb{background: url(../img/Slicehbs.png)center center no-repeat;height: 60px;left: 300px;top: 121px;background-size: 100% 100%;}
.sjqd .fl  .jy{background: url(../img/Slicejys.png)center center no-repeat;height: 60px;left: 155px;top: 114px;background-size: 100% 100%;}
.sjqd .fl  .jz{background: url(../img/Slicejzs.png)center center no-repeat;height: 60px;left: 201px;top: 118px;background-size: 100% 100%;}
.sjqd .fl  .xx{background: url(../img/Slicexxs.png)center center no-repeat;height: 60px;left: 253px;top: 151px;background-size: 100% 100%;}
.sjqd .fl  .kf{background: url(../img/Slicekfs.png)center center no-repeat;height: 60px;left: 326px;top: 204px;background-size: 100% 100%;}
.sjqd .fl  .smx{background: url(../img/Slicesmx.png)center center no-repeat;height: 73px;left: 61px;top: 248px;background-size: 100% 100%;}
.sjqd .fl  .ly{background: url(../img/Slicelys.png)center center no-repeat;height: 60px;left: 124px;top: 242px;background-size: 100% 100%;}
.sjqd .fl  .xc{background: url(../img/Slicexcs.png)center center no-repeat;height: 60px;left: 242px;top: 253px;background-size: 100% 100%;}
.sjqd .fl  .sq{background: url(../img/Slicesqs.png)center center no-repeat;height: 60px;left: 377px;top: 224px;background-size: 100% 100%;}
.sjqd .fl  .lh{background: url(../img/Slicelhs.png)center center no-repeat;height: 73px;left: 273px;top: 288px;background-size: 100% 100%;}
.sjqd .fl  .zk{background: url(../img/Slicezks.png)center center no-repeat;height: 60px;left: 328px;top: 292px;background-size: 100% 100%;}
.sjqd .fl  .ny{background: url(../img/Slicenys.png)center center no-repeat;height: 60px;left: 144px;top: 345px;background-size: 100% 100%;}
.sjqd .fl  .xy{background: url(../img/Slicexys.png)center center no-repeat;height: 60px;left: 320px;top: 438px;background-size: 100% 100%;}
.sjqd .fl  .pds{background: url(../img/Slicepds.png)center center no-repeat;height: 73px;left: 193px;top: 276px;background-size: 100% 100%;}
.sjqd .fl  .zmd{background: url(../img/Slicezmd.png)center center no-repeat;height: 73px;left: 275px;top: 360px;background-size: 100% 100%;}

.sjqd .fl  .zz.active{background: url(../img/Slicezzsh.png)center center no-repeat;height: 60px;left: 212px;top: 204px;background-size: 100% 100%;}
.sjqd .fl  .ay.active{background: url(../img/Sliceaysh.png)center center no-repeat;height: 60px;left: 259px;top: 50px;background-size: 100% 100%;}
.sjqd .fl  .py.active{background: url(../img/Slicepysh.png)center center no-repeat;height: 60px;left: 345px;top: 70px;background-size: 100% 100%;}
.sjqd .fl  .hb.active{background: url(../img/Slicehbsh.png)center center no-repeat;height: 60px;left: 300px;top: 121px;background-size: 100% 100%;}
.sjqd .fl  .jy.active{background: url(../img/Slicejysh.png)center center no-repeat;height: 60px;left: 155px;top: 114px;background-size: 100% 100%;}
.sjqd .fl  .jz.active{background: url(../img/Slicejzsh.png)center center no-repeat;height: 60px;left: 201px;top: 118px;background-size: 100% 100%;}
.sjqd .fl  .xx.active{background: url(../img/Slicexxsh.png)center center no-repeat;height: 60px;left: 253px;top: 151px;background-size: 100% 100%;}
.sjqd .fl  .kf.active{background: url(../img/Slicekfsh.png)center center no-repeat;height: 60px;left: 326px;top: 204px;background-size: 100% 100%;}
.sjqd .fl  .smx.active{background: url(../img/Slicesmxh.png)center center no-repeat;height: 73px;left: 61px;top: 248px;background-size: 100% 100%;}
.sjqd .fl  .ly.active{background: url(../img/Slicelysh.png)center center no-repeat;height: 60px;left: 124px;top: 242px;background-size: 100% 100%;}
.sjqd .fl  .xc.active{background: url(../img/Slicexcsh.png)center center no-repeat;height: 60px;left: 242px;top: 253px;background-size: 100% 100%;}
.sjqd .fl  .sq.active{background: url(../img/Slicesqsh.png)center center no-repeat;height: 60px;left: 377px;top: 224px;background-size: 100% 100%;}
.sjqd .fl  .lh.active{background: url(../img/Slicelhsh.png)center center no-repeat;height: 73px;left: 273px;top: 288px;background-size: 100% 100%;}
.sjqd .fl  .zk.active{background: url(../img/Slicezksh.png)center center no-repeat;height: 60px;left: 328px;top: 292px;background-size: 100% 100%;}
.sjqd .fl  .ny.active{background: url(../img/Slicenysh.png)center center no-repeat;height: 60px;left: 144px;top: 345px;background-size: 100% 100%;}
.sjqd .fl  .xy.active{background: url(../img/Slicexysh.png)center center no-repeat;height: 60px;left: 320px;top: 438px;background-size: 100% 100%;}
.sjqd .fl  .pds.active{background: url(../img/Slicepdsh.png)center center no-repeat;height: 73px;left: 193px;top: 276px;background-size: 100% 100%;}
.sjqd .fl  .zmd.active{background: url(../img/Slicezmdh.png)center center no-repeat;height: 73px;left: 275px;top: 360px;background-size: 100% 100%;}

.sjqd .bd .fr ul li{width: 328px;float: left;background: url(../img/Slicelibg.png)left center no-repeat;padding-left: 20px; color: #333333;font-size: 18px;line-height: 42px;}
.sjqd .bd .fr ul li span{
width: 86px;
height: 30px;
border-radius: 4px;
background: #FFFAF8;
text-align: center;
line-height: 30px;
display: inline-block;
 color: #ac816f;
 font-size: 16px;
 margin-left: 11px;
}
.sjqd .bd .fr ul .more{
color: #fff0e0;
width: 128px;
height: 43px;
border-radius: 78px;
background: #D40901;
text-align: center;
line-height: 43px;
display: block;
position: absolute;
bottom: 0;
left: 50%;
transform: translateX(-50%);
}
.info>div{position: relative;max-height: 447px;padding-bottom: 50px;}